The runners were observed on a treadmill machine (跑步机).
Sometimes they wore running shoes. Other times they ran barefoot (赤脚的).
Researchers from the JKM Technologies company in Virginia, the University of Virginia and the University of Colorado did the study.
They found that running shoes create more stress that could damage knees, hips and ankle joints than running barefoot. They observed that the effect was even greater than the effect reported earlier for walking in high heels.
The study appeared in the official scientific journal of the American Academy of Physical Medicine.
The other study appeared in the journal Nature. It compared runners in the United States and Kenya. The researchers
were
from
Harvard
University
in Massachusetts,
Moi
University
in
Kenya
and
the University of Glasgow in Scotland.
They divided the runners into three groups.
One group had always run shoeless.
Another group had always run with shoes. And the third group had changed to shoeless running.
Runners who wear shoes usually come down heel first. That puts great force on the back of the foot. But the study found that barefoot runners generally land on the front or middle of their foot. That way they ease into their landing and avoid striking their heels.
